Understanding GamStop and Reasons Players Look for Alternatives
GamStop is a complimentary self-exclusion program launched in 2018, allowing UK gamblers to voluntarily restrict their access to gaming websites regulated by the UK Gambling Commission. When players sign up with GamStop, they choose an exclusion period of six months, one year, or 5 years, during which they cannot access participating gambling sites. This service aims to help those struggling with gambling problems by providing a comprehensive barrier across all UKGC-licensed operators simultaneously.
